lib/kit/bit.rb in kit-0.1.1 vs lib/kit/bit.rb in kit-0.1.2
- old
+ new
@@ -72,10 +72,10 @@
# Raises a DuplicateElement if a bit with unique values already exists.
def insert_new
uniq = @@unique[:bits].hash_ivars self
uniq.each { |x| fail MissingValues if x.nil? }
- fail DuplicateElement if lookup_id uniq
+ fail DuplicateElement if ( lookup_id uniq ).first
data = @@info[:bits].hash_ivars self, [ :rowid ]
@@db.insert_info :bits, data
end